Harold James makes history as L’Oréal Paris’s first Black global makeup artist, bringing his expertise in inclusive beauty and commitment to diverse shade ranges to the world’s top makeup brand.
Octavia Morgan’s clean, science-backed fragrance brand is now at Ulta Beauty, marking the first Black and woman-owned prestige fragrance in the retailer’s history.
Sarah Brown opens Beauty Trap, Columbia’s first Black-owned beauty supply store, aiming to empower the community and create a family legacy in the beauty industry.
